ALLEN, FELTUS GO 1-2 IN THROWING EVENTS TO LEAD TUFTS AT BOWDOIN

COLLEGE WOMEN'S INDOOR TRACK & FIELD RESULTS
Bowdoin Invitational
At Brunswick, ME
Saturday, January 30, 2010

Meet Results
Julia Feltus won the weight throw and was second in the shot put at Bowdoin
 

BRUNSWICK, Me. -- Senior Julia Feltus (Reading, MA) and first-year Kelly Allen (Norton, MA) combined to score 36 points in the shot put and weight throw events, leading the Tufts women's indoor track & field team at the Bowdoin Invitational on Saturday.

Tufts placed third out of four teams, scoring 112.5 points. MIT won the meet with a 210.5 score, followed by the host Polar Bears with 159 points.

In the shot put, Allen was first and Feltus was second with distances of 39'2 1/4" (11.95m) and 36'7 1/2" (11.16m), respectively. They switched spots in the weight throw, with Feltus winning at 43'4 1/4" (13.21m) and Allen taking runner-up with a 39'11 1/2" (12.18m) toss.

Coach Kristen Morwick's Jumbos won three events overall. Senior Logan Crane (Portland, ME) was first in the 55-meter dash with a time of 7.61 seconds. She had run a time of 7.51 seconds to win the preliminaries.

Like Crane, sophomore Nakeisha Jones (Boston, MA) was competing for the second straight day. Both were at the Boston University Terrier Invitational on Friday. Jones improved her NCAA provisional mark in the triple jump at BU. At Bowdoin, she was second in the high jump with clearance of 4'11 3/4" (1.52m).

Tufts hosts its second invitational of the 2009-10 season at the Gantcher Center next weekend (Feb. 5-6).
